Ulutrionyx ninae Chkhikvadze 1971 (softshell turtle)

Reptilia - Testudines - Trionychidae

Full reference: V. M. Chkhikvadze. 1971. [New turtles from the Oligocene of Kazakhstan and the systematic position of some species in Mongolia]. Soobshcheniya Akademii Nauk Gruzinskoi SSR 62:489-492

Belongs to Ulutrionyx according to N. S. Vitek and I. G. Danilov 2015

Sister taxa: none

Type specimen: IPGAS KK-19, a partial shell (left hypoplastron). Its type locality is Kizyl-Kak, which is in an Oligocene terrestrial horizon in the Betpakdala Formation of Kazakhstan.

Ecology: aquatic piscivore-carnivore

Distribution: found only at Myn-Sai
